当前位置:首页 / EXCEL

Excel表格图片隐藏显示怎么做?如何快速切换显示?

作者:佚名|分类:EXCEL|浏览:55|发布时间:2025-03-17 00:58:58

Excel表格图片隐藏显示怎么做?如何快速切换显示?

在Excel中,有时候我们需要对表格中的图片进行隐藏或显示,以便于数据的展示或者编辑。以下是一些详细的步骤,帮助你轻松实现图片的隐藏和显示,以及如何快速切换显示状态。

一、Excel表格图片隐藏显示的基本操作

1. 插入图片

打开Excel表格,点击“插入”选项卡。

在“插图”组中,点击“图片”按钮。

选择你想要插入的图片文件,点击“插入”。

2. 隐藏图片

选中插入的图片。

在“格式”选项卡中,点击“位置”组中的“锁定位置”按钮,取消勾选,这样图片就可以自由移动了。

将图片拖动到工作表的任意位置,确保它不在表格的可见区域内。

选中图片,按下“Ctrl+1”打开“格式图片”对话框。

在“大小”选项卡中,将“缩放比例”设置为“100%”。

在“版式”选项卡中,选择“浮于文字上方”。

点击“关闭”按钮,此时图片将不可见。

3. 显示图片

将图片拖动回工作表的可见区域内。

选中图片,按下“Ctrl+1”打开“格式图片”对话框。

在“版式”选项卡中,选择“嵌入型”。

点击“关闭”按钮,图片将恢复显示。

二、如何快速切换显示

为了快速切换图片的显示状态,你可以使用以下方法:

1. 使用快捷键

在图片上右击,选择“大小和位置”。

在弹出的对话框中,将“缩放比例”设置为“100%”。

在“版式”选项卡中,选择“浮于文字上方”或“嵌入型”,根据需要切换显示状态。

2. 使用VBA宏

打开Excel,按下“Alt+F11”进入VBA编辑器。

在“插入”菜单中选择“模块”,在打开的代码窗口中输入以下代码:

```vba

Sub TogglePictureVisibility()

Dim pic As Picture

For Each pic In ActiveSheet.Pictures

If pic.Top > 0 And pic.Left > 0 Then

pic.LockAspectRatio = msoFalse

pic.Width = 0

pic.Height = 0

Else

pic.LockAspectRatio = msoTrue

pic.Width = 100

pic.Height = 100

End If

Next pic

End Sub

```

关闭VBA编辑器,回到Excel界面。

按下“Alt+F8”,选择“TogglePictureVisibility”宏,点击“运行”。

三、相关问答

1. 如何在Excel中批量隐藏或显示多个图片?

可以使用VBA宏来实现。在VBA编辑器中编写一个循环,遍历所有图片,根据条件进行隐藏或显示。

2. 隐藏图片后,如何快速找到图片的位置?

可以在“格式图片”对话框中,将图片的缩放比例设置为“100%”,这样即使图片不可见,也可以通过调整大小来定位图片的位置。

3. 隐藏图片后,如何恢复图片的原始大小?

在“格式图片”对话框中,将“缩放比例”设置为“100%”,然后点击“关闭”按钮,图片将恢复到原始大小。

通过以上步骤,你可以轻松地在Excel中实现图片的隐藏和显示,以及快速切换显示状态。希望这些信息能帮助你更高效地使用Excel。